Its really all up to you. Sony's ps vita will be best for fps and all around has a good overall design and build to it. To me, library is lacking a lot. I dont have one by the way. Also it is very expensive due to the memory cards you would need to buy and the console is just more expensive in general.

3ds is my console of choice. If you haven't purchased one but are thinking about it, GET THE XL!! regular 3ds has so many poor design choices, such as screen scratching (get screen protectors) stylus placement (not a deal breaker though) and my biggest pet peeve, it has a freaking glossy finish ON THE INSIDE OF IT!!! the most fingerprint magnetic gaming device ever!! Get the xl... But as for the library, 3ds is freaking amazing!! We have great retail games like monster hunter 3 ultimate, etrian odyssey 4 (my favorite 3ds game and 3rd fave game ever) and soon to get a zelda lttp inspired game!! Can't freaking wait!! Also has amazing eshop games like mutant mudds and the denpa men.

Go for vita if you want
1. First person shooter games
2. Better build quality
3. A decent battery life

3ds for
1. Okay build quality
2. Amazing games of all genres
3. If you will be near your charger often
4. Much cheaper then vita overall
